Vanessa Armel work experience
A career timeline built from the work history available for this profile.
Process Development Engineer
-Designing innovative cost effective electrodes and electrolyte material -Optimisation of electrode slurry composition (ink formulation) and processing techniques for targeted application.-Designed of novel polymer electrolyte for high energy and power density solid state lithium ion micro-batteries.-Understanding the limitation, physico-chemical properties and electrochemical properties of the polymer electrolyte.-Improvement of the transport properties and mechanical strength of polymer membrane by addition of additives and nano fillers respectively.-Collaborative work with other team member in the design of a prototype for targeted application.-Integration of polymer electrolyte in a lithium ion micro-batteries prototype.- Reporting and data collection from electrochemical test and monthly status updates related to the development effortsKEY ACHIEVEMENT* Improvement in transport properties and reduction of electrode polarisation * Four patents on the development of novel electrode, novel electrolyte
Material R&D Engineer
-Use comprehensive management and research skills in the development of innovative materials for fuel cells application-Coordinate and manage a broad range of research activities including monthly and annual reporting-Designed novel and efficient materials for the reduction of oxygen for PEMFCs-Synthesis, characterisation and evaluation of non-noble electrocatalytic material -In-situ and ex-situ investigation of materials stability in different environment-Data analysis, fuel cells testing- Analytical, thermal and electrochemical analysis of catalysts-Liaison with suppliers and collaborators -International collaboration with Johnson Matthey KEY ACHIEVEMENTS* Use of a key descriptor for the design of novel materials which can lead to significant enhancement in fuel cell performance. This achievement has led to a patent application and the development of a new project.* Designed novel and efficient catalyst with enhanced mass activity for oxygen reduction reaction for PEMFC.* Collaboration work on the synthesis and characterization of carbon material for supercapacitor.
Research And Development Engineer
Development of conducting polymers for fuels cells and biosensors.Duties:-Designed of electrodes made of hybrid polymers by electrochemical and vapour phase polymerisation-Investigating the physic-chemical properties (Raman, FTIR, XRD, MEB, UV) and electrochemical properties of the composite polymers electrodes.-Thermal analysis (TGA, DSC) of polymers -Management of students.-Preparation and presentation of technical reports-In charge of certain Equipements
Phd Researcher
-Synthesis and characterisation of ionic liquids and organic ionic plastic crystals as electrolytes-Fabrication of dye sensitised solar cells (screen printing and doctor blading)-Synthesis of photocatalytic ceramic (TiO2, Niobium oxide) by sol-gel process-Significant improvement in photovoltaic devices through the designed and method of fabrication.-Investigate the effect of ionic liquids at the semi-conductor interface -Effet of acid treatment on TiO2 surfaces and characterisation of electrical properties of the cells
Intern
Investigate novel material for oxygen reduction reaction for regenerative fuel cells.Characterisation of the material by XRD and SEM
